You will just need to create a text file with one or more columns, one for each 
regressor put this in the run folder (same folder where the raw data are). When 
you run mkanalysis-sess, add
-nuisreg filename N
where N is the number of columns you want to include

Hi all,


I am currently developing a pipeline to remove physiological noise (respiratory 
and cardiac) from rsMRI images. I am at the point where I have created the 
regressors using fast_retroicor.m from the physiological data logs. When I add 
the columns of the regressors up and plot the result, it appears to create 
pulses at the times when the physiological data peaked. I was wondering if 
anyone knows how to incorporate the regressor files into FreeSurfer. Please let 
me know at your earliest convenience.
